National Parks Of Pakistan In Pakistan a National Park is an area of outstanding scenic merit and natural beauty where the landscape, flora and fauna are protected and preserved in a natural state. Public access for recreation, education and research is provided for. Access roads and other facilities should be planned so they do not conflict with the main objectives of national parks. Hunting wild animals is prohibited, as is firing gun or otherwise interfering with animals and plants. Clearing land for cultivation, mining or allowing polluted water to flow in National Parks is also prohibited. Under the regulations, these acts may be allowed for scientific purposes or to improve the park. There are 14 National Parks in Pakistan. Following are the major National Parks of Pakistan: Hingol National Park (Makran Costal Region, Balochistan) Kirthar National Park (Kirthar mountains Karachi & Jamshoro, Sindh) Khunjerab National Park (Karakoram Mountains, Hunza) Chitral Gol National Park (Chitral District, Kpk) Lal Suhanra National Park (Bahawalpur, Punjab) Hazarganji-Chiltan National Park (Quetta, Balochistan) Margalla Hills National Park (Islamabad, Capital City) Ayubia National Park (Abbottabad, Kpk) Deosai National Park (Skardu, Gilgit-Baltistan) Machiara National Park (Nelum Valley, Azad Kashmir) Chinji National Park (Talagang, Punjab) Broghil National Park (Chitral, Kpk) Detail In Description with Pictures
